/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
/中文/
LiteIDE是一款非常不錯的go語言開發(fā)工具,是由國人開發(fā)的輕量級開發(fā)工具,支持大量拓展插件、代碼編寫、文本替換功能,兼容性強,能夠為你提供一個舒適的開發(fā)環(huán)境,有需要的用戶歡迎下載使用!
核心功能
系統(tǒng)環(huán)境管理
MIME類型管理
可配置的構建命令
支持文件搜索替換和還原
快速打開文件,符號和命令
插件系統(tǒng)
先進的代碼編輯器
代碼編輯器支持Golang, Markdown和Golang Present
快速代碼導航工具
語法突出顯示和配色方案
代碼自動完成
代碼折疊
顯示保存修改
通過內(nèi)部差異方式重新加載文件
Golang支持
支持Go1.11 Go模塊
支持Go1.5 Go供應商
支持Go1 GOPATH
戈朗建設環(huán)境管理
使用標準的Golang工具進行編譯和測試
自定義GOPATH支持系統(tǒng),IDE和項目
自定義項目構建配置
Golang包瀏覽器
Golang類視圖和大綱
Golang doc搜索和api索引
源代碼導航和信息提示
源代碼查找用法
源代碼重構和還原
集成的gocode克隆的nsf/gocode
集成gomodifytags
支持源代碼查詢工具guru
使用GDB進行調(diào)試并深入研究
LiteIDE
添加新的編輯器路徑導航工具欄
QuickOpen
快速打開文件過濾器文本長度小于3使用編輯器文件,否則搜索文件夾文件。
添加新的quickfilesystem過濾器
GolangEdit
使用新的quickfilesystem進行導入跳轉(zhuǎn)
LiteEditor
添加新的路徑導航工具欄(使用quickfilesystem)
GolangCode
修正數(shù)字+點問題完成
FileUtil
在macOS上顯示Finder fast
使用教程
鍵盤映射:
您可以修改用于LiteIDE所有的功能快捷鍵。打開 查看 -> 選項 -> LiteApp -> 鍵盤 并修改快捷鍵。雙擊該快捷鍵列表進行編輯,然后按'應用'以執(zhí)行更改。
快捷鍵必須遵循特定的格式。快捷鍵通?梢允褂逗號(,)分隔,即按順序按下對應的快捷鍵以啟動功能。而定義支持多個快捷鍵則用分號(';')進行分隔。
舉例:
Ctrl+B
Ctrl+Shift+B
Ctrl+K,Ctrl+U
Ctrl+Y;Ctrl+Shift+Z
Go語言代碼格式化:
存盤時自動格式化
Goimports樣式格式化:
LiteIDE 查看->選項->GolangFmt-> 使用Goimports代替gofmt進行代碼格式化
這個工具自動更新您的Go語言import行,增加缺少的pkg和移除未引用的pkg。
快速打開窗口:
快速打開 Ctrl+P
快速打開文檔 Ctrl+Alt+P 或者在快速打開窗口輸入 ~
快速跳轉(zhuǎn)符號 Ctrl+Shift+O 或者在快速打開窗口輸入 @
快速跳轉(zhuǎn)到行 Ctrl+L 或者在快速打開窗口輸入 :
獲取幫助 在快速打開窗口輸入 ?
如何支持低版本Go1.1和Go1.2
LiteIDE的編譯設置使用了-i編譯參數(shù)。如果使用Go1.1或Go1.2則不支持此參數(shù)。選項->查看->LiteBuild 雙擊gosrc.xml進行編輯。修改BUILDARGS默認設置:
<custom id="BuildArgsi" name="BUILDARGS" value="-i"/>
將value設置為空存盤重啟LiteIDE即可支持Go1.1和Go1.2。
窗口樣式設置
LiteIDE目前有兩種窗口樣式分離式和側邊欄式。
選項->查看->LiteApp-> 窗口樣式。
環(huán)境設置
LiteIDE環(huán)境設置插件可以讓你快速設置切換多個系統(tǒng)環(huán)境,以便編譯構建,每個環(huán)境都可配置自己需要的環(huán)境變量。
選擇當前環(huán)境
工具欄中的下拉菜單可以用來選擇目前用于編譯構建/運行的環(huán)境。
主要系統(tǒng)的一些常用環(huán)境列表
Windows - win64 win32
Linux - linux64 linux32
MacOSX - darwin64 darwin32
可選擇使用交叉編譯環(huán)境,請參看下面的交叉編譯設置。
配置環(huán)境
環(huán)境中的變量可以通過手工進行修改。要編輯當前環(huán)境,只要按一下環(huán)境下拉列表旁的編輯環(huán)境按鈕。
另外,也可以查看>選項> LiteEnv面板中對所有環(huán)境進行查看和編輯。
舉例 win32.env:
#win32 environment
GOROOT=c:\go
#GOBIN=
GOARCH=386
GOOS=windows
PATH=c:\mingw32\bin;%GOROOT%\bin;%PATH%
LITEIDE_GDB=gdb
LITEIDE_MAKE=mingw32-make
LITEIDE_TERMARGS=
LITEIDE_EXEC=%COMSPEC%
LITEIDE_EXECOPT=/C
舉例 linux32.env:
#linux32 environment
GOROOT=$HOME/go
#GOBIN=
GOARCH=386
GOOS=linux
PATH=$GOROOT/bin:$PATH
LITEIDE_GDB=gdb
LITEIDE_MAKE=make
LITEIDE_TERM=/usr/bin/gnome-terminal
LITEIDE_TERMARGS=
LITEIDE_EXEC=/usr/bin/xterm
LITEIDE_EXECOPT=-e
關于騰牛 | 聯(lián)系方式 | 發(fā)展歷程 | 版權聲明 | 下載幫助(?) | 廣告聯(lián)系 | 網(wǎng)站地圖 | 友情鏈接
Copyright 2005-2024 QQTN.com 【騰牛網(wǎng)】 版權所有 鄂ICP備2022005668號-1 | 鄂公網(wǎng)安備 42011102000260號
聲明:本站非騰訊QQ官方網(wǎng)站 所有軟件和文章來自互聯(lián)網(wǎng) 如有異議 請與本站聯(lián)系 本站為非贏利性網(wǎng)站 不接受任何贊助和廣告